As the planet warms, animals living in tropical mountains may find it increasingly difficult to shift to new areas, according to a new study. Tropical mountains are particularly at risk when the impacts of climate change combine with changes in land use and human pressures, Chiara Dragonetti, co-author of the study published in June, told Mongabay in a video call. Many mountain-dwelling species are endemic to those areas and can only tolerate climatic conditions within narrow limits, researchers have previously found. Higher altitudes may be the right temperature but the wrong habitat, and species already living at high altitudes can only shift so high. Eventually, animals can run out of safe space on a mountain in a pattern scientists have dubbed an “escalator to extinction.” Changes in how mountain land is used can further limit animals’ movement. Dragonetti wanted to understand how mountain wildlife will fare in a warming world, while also considering land-use changes and the species’ dispersal abilities. She and her colleagues analyzed existing global datasets of distribution for 395 different mountain-dwelling species, including 361 birds and 34 mammals, breaking them down by animals that can easily disperse, such as birds, and those that can’t easily relocate, such as sloths. They then used computer models to project where these species could occur in 2050, under future high and low greenhouse gas emissions scenarios.
